The Google Pixel 8 Pro, released in October 2023, and the iPhone SE 2022, launched in March 2022, represent distinct approaches to smartphone design and functionality. While the Pixel 8 Pro offers a large, modern display and an advanced camera system running on Android, the iPhone SE 2022 provides a compact form factor with a classic design and Apple's iOS ecosystem. These devices cater to different user preferences, primarily differing in their operating systems, screen technology, and camera capabilities.

Durability

When considering the longevity of these devices, several factors come into play, including their release timelines, software support, and physical durability.

  • Release Timeline and Software Support: The Google Pixel 8 Pro, being a newer device from late 2023, is promised an extensive seven years of operating system and security updates, extending its software relevance significantly into the future. The iPhone SE 2022, released in early 2022, typically receives 5-6 years of iOS updates from its launch date, offering a solid but shorter support window compared to the Pixel 8 Pro.
  • Durability Features: The Pixel 8 Pro features Gorilla Glass Victus 2 on the front and Gorilla Glass on the back, along with an IP68 rating for dust and water resistance. The iPhone SE 2022 incorporates a durable glass on the front and back, similar to the iPhone 13 series, and carries an IP67 rating for dust and water resistance.
  • Expected Practical Lifespan: Users prioritizing the longest possible software support and access to the latest features will find the Pixel 8 Pro's extended update commitment appealing. Both devices are built to withstand daily use, but the Pixel 8 Pro's longer software support suggests a potentially longer practical lifespan for receiving new functionalities and security patches.

Performance

The performance of a smartphone is crucial for daily tasks, app usage, and overall responsiveness. Both devices offer capable performance, though with different underlying architectures.

  • Processor Capabilities: The Google Pixel 8 Pro is equipped with a current-generation processor designed for efficient handling of demanding applications, advanced AI features, and smooth multitasking. The iPhone SE 2022 features a powerful chip that delivers very fast performance for its class, easily managing everyday apps, gaming, and video editing tasks.
  • Multitasking and Responsiveness: The Pixel 8 Pro typically includes a generous amount of RAM, contributing to seamless multitasking and quick app switching. The iPhone SE 2022, while having less RAM, is optimized by its operating system to maintain fluid performance and responsiveness across applications.
  • Storage Options and Battery Behavior: The Pixel 8 Pro offers various storage configurations, including options up to 1TB, catering to users with extensive storage needs. The iPhone SE 2022 is available with up to 256GB of internal storage. The Pixel 8 Pro generally features a larger battery capacity, which translates to extended usage between charges for many users, while the iPhone SE 2022's smaller battery capacity means more frequent charging for heavy users.

Screen quality

The display is a primary interface for smartphone interaction, and these two models present significantly different viewing experiences.

  • Display Technology and Size: The Google Pixel 8 Pro features a large 6.7-inch LTPO OLED display, offering deep blacks, vibrant colors, and a high contrast ratio. The iPhone SE 2022 has a more compact 4.7-inch IPS LCD display, which provides good color accuracy but does not match the contrast levels of an OLED panel.
  • Resolution and Refresh Rate: The Pixel 8 Pro boasts a high resolution of 1344 x 2992 pixels, resulting in sharp images and text, and an adaptive refresh rate that can go from 1Hz to 120Hz for smooth scrolling and animations. The iPhone SE 2022 has a resolution of 750 x 1334 pixels and a standard 60Hz refresh rate.
  • Brightness and Outdoor Visibility: The Pixel 8 Pro's display can reach high peak brightness levels, making it highly visible even in direct sunlight. The iPhone SE 2022 offers a respectable brightness for an LCD panel, providing adequate visibility in most lighting conditions.

Audiovisual

Camera capabilities are a key differentiator, with each device offering distinct photographic strengths.

  • Camera System Configuration: The Google Pixel 8 Pro features a versatile triple-camera system, including a high-resolution main sensor, an ultrawide lens, and a telephoto lens with optical zoom. The iPhone SE 2022 is equipped with a single 12MP wide camera on the rear.
  • Photography Performance: The Pixel 8 Pro excels in computational photography, offering advanced features for low-light performance, detail retention, and AI-enhanced editing. Its telephoto lens allows for detailed zoomed-in shots. The iPhone SE 2022 benefits from its powerful processor to deliver strong everyday photography with features like Smart HDR 4 and Photographic Styles, though it lacks a dedicated Night Mode.
  • Video Recording and Audio: Both phones are capable of recording 4K video at up to 60 frames per second. The Pixel 8 Pro's advanced camera system may offer more flexibility in video capture. Both devices provide good microphone quality for calls and recording, and feature stereo speakers for media consumption.

Miscellaneous

Beyond the core features, several other practical elements contribute to the overall user experience.

  • Connectivity and Ports: Both devices support 5G connectivity, enabling faster download and upload speeds. The Pixel 8 Pro supports Wi-Fi 7 and Bluetooth 5.3, while the iPhone SE 2022 supports Wi-Fi 6 and Bluetooth 5.0. The Pixel 8 Pro uses a USB-C port, whereas the iPhone SE 2022 utilizes a Lightning port.
  • Biometric Security: The Pixel 8 Pro offers in-display fingerprint scanning and Face Unlock for secure authentication. The iPhone SE 2022 features Touch ID, integrated into its home button, for fingerprint recognition.
  • Design and Handling: The Pixel 8 Pro has a modern, larger design with a polished aluminum frame and a matte glass back. The iPhone SE 2022 retains a classic iPhone design with a physical home button, an aerospace-grade aluminum frame, and a glass back, making it a more compact and lightweight option.

The Google Pixel 8 Pro and iPhone SE 2022 cater to distinct user needs and preferences. Users often praise the Pixel 8 Pro for its exceptional camera capabilities, particularly its advanced computational photography and AI features, as well as its vibrant, large display and extended software support. Some common criticisms might revolve around its larger size, which may not appeal to all users seeking a compact device. Conversely, the iPhone SE 2022 is frequently lauded for its compact form factor, the familiarity of its classic design with Touch ID, and its robust performance for its size. Users appreciate its integration into the Apple ecosystem. However, common concerns often include its smaller, less advanced LCD display, the absence of a dedicated Night Mode for its camera, and its relatively smaller battery capacity compared to modern smartphones.

Users prioritizing a cutting-edge camera system, a large and immersive display, and the longest possible software longevity may find the Google Pixel 8 Pro well-suited to their needs. Its advanced features and modern design make it ideal for those who engage heavily with multimedia and require extensive processing power. On the other hand, users who prefer a compact device, value the traditional home button with Touch ID, and are deeply integrated into the iOS ecosystem may lean toward the iPhone SE 2022. It offers reliable performance for everyday tasks in a highly portable package.
